2023年MySQL期末考试试题及答案解析——助你顺利通关!
随着数据库技术的不断发展,MySQL作为一款开源、高性能、易用的关系型数据库管理系统,受到了广大开发者的青睐。为了帮助大家更好地掌握MySQL知识,本文将为大家提供一份2023年MySQL期末考试试题及答案解析,助你顺利通关!
一、选择题
MySQL是一种什么类型的数据库管理系统? A. 关系型数据库 B. 文件型数据库 C. 键值对数据库 D. 图数据库 答案:A
下列哪个是MySQL的官方客户端? A. MySQL Workbench B. Navicat C. SQLyog D. PHPMyAdmin 答案:A
以下哪个是MySQL中的数据类型? A. INT B. DATE C. FLOAT D. ALL 答案:ABC
以下哪个是MySQL中的索引类型? A. 单列索引 B. 联合索引 C. 全文索引 D. 全局索引 答案:ABC
以下哪个是MySQL中的事务特性? A. 原子性 B. 一致性 C. 隔离性 D. 可持久性 答案:ABCD
二、填空题
MySQL数据库中,存储数据的文件类型主要有__和__。 答案:.frm、.myd
在MySQL中,创建表的语句是__。 答案:CREATE TABLE
在MySQL中,删除表的语句是__。 答案:DROP TABLE
在MySQL中,修改表结构的语句是__。 答案:ALTER TABLE
在MySQL中,查询数据的语句是__。 答案:SELECT
三、判断题
MySQL数据库中的数据类型共有50多种。( ) 答案:错误
在MySQL中,所有表的数据都存储在同一个文件中。( ) 答案:错误
在MySQL中,事务必须是原子的,要么全部完成,要么全部不做。( ) 答案:正确
在MySQL中,可以使用SELECT语句删除表中的数据。( ) 答案:错误
在MySQL中,可以使用ALTER TABLE语句修改表名。( ) 答案:正确
四、简答题
简述MySQL数据库的事务特性。 答案:MySQL数据库的事务特性包括原子性、一致性、隔离性和可持久性。其中,原子性指的是事务中的所有操作要么全部完成,要么全部不做;一致性指的是事务执行的结果必须是使数据库从一个一致性状态转移到另一个一致性状态;隔离性指的是一个事务的执行不能被其他事务干扰;可持久性指的是一个事务一旦提交,其所做的更改就会永久保存在数据库中。
简述MySQL数据库中的索引类型及其作用。 答案:MySQL数据库中的索引类型包括单列索引、联合索引、全文索引等。其中,单列索引指的是只包含一个列的索引;联合索引指的是包含多个列的索引;全文索引适用于全文检索的场景。索引可以提高查询效率,降低查询成本。
五、综合题
请编写一个SQL语句,创建一个名为“students”的表,包含以下字段:id(主键)、name(姓名)、age(年龄)、gender(性别)。 答案:CREATE TABLE students ( id INT PRIMARY KEY, name VARCHAR(50), age INT, gender ENUM('male', 'female') );
请编写一个SQL语句,查询“students”表中所有年龄大于20岁的男性学生信息。 答案:SELECT * FROM students WHERE age > 20 AND gender = 'male';
通过对以上试题及答案的解析,相信大家对MySQL数据库有了更深入的了解。在备考过程中,希望大家能够多加练习,熟练掌握MySQL的基本操作和高级特性,为考试做好充分准备。祝大家考试顺利!
当前文章不喜欢?试试AI生成哦!SQL语句生成器 AI生成仅供参考!
上一篇:欧冠赛程规则图表大全集
下一篇:曼联欧冠2020遭淘汰了吗视频